Funeral Industry Award Classification Levels 2025–26

Rates effective 7 November 2025 · MA000105

Your classification level under the Funeral Industry Award determines your minimum pay rate. Being classified one level too low can cost you $2–4 per hour — more than $3,000 per year for a full-time worker.

Classification levels

Level 1Funeral Industry Employee Grade 1

Base rate: $24.28/hr · Casual: $30.35/hr

Level 2Funeral Industry Employee Grade 2

Base rate: $24.95/hr · Casual: $31.19/hr

Level 3Funeral Industry Employee Grade 3

Base rate: $25.85/hr · Casual: $32.31/hr

Level 4Funeral Industry Employee Grade 4

Base rate: $26.70/hr · Casual: $33.38/hr

Level 5Funeral Industry Employee Grade 5

Base rate: $28.12/hr · Casual: $35.15/hr

Level 6Funeral Industry Employee Grade 6

Base rate: $29.00/hr · Casual: $36.25/hr
